Pretty much every major manufacturer makes early season gear now. Academys game winner brand early season apparel is nice and won't kill you at the cashier either. Only problem with them is finding your size. After that, go with redhead. Oh and buy a thermacell.
Posted on 10/5/15 at 9:31 pm to The Last Coco
I wore a Cabelas Hunt Tech 1/4 zip top with a merino base layer this weekend in Ark and it was perfect. It was low 50's in morning but if it would have been in the 70's-80's that shirt would have been perfect by itself. I also have some Cabelas Microtex pants and shirt and it is fantastic quality. Fairly expensive but it is worth it. It's actually on sale right now. This stuff is about the toughest outer material Ive ever owned. Similar to Carhartt duck material but softer.

I have a suit of the Redhead EnduraSkin. It wicks the heat off of your body, though the camo pattern is lacking in definition, but it works great under a leaf suit.
